Is Martin's Sandwich Potato Bread Loaf, 18 Ounces, Sliced Vegetarian?

This product may or may not be vegetarian as it lists 8 ingredients that could derive from meat or fish depending on the source. We recommend contacting the manufacturer directly to confirm.

Description

Soft, slightly sweet sandwich bread with even, square slices offering a pillowy texture and mild flavor. Reviewers commonly note consistent slice thickness and durability for stacked sandwiches, grilled cheese, toast, and French toast. Texture holds up to spreading and heating, while remaining tender and easy to chew throughout the day.

Ingredients

Unbleached Enriched Wheat Flour (Flour, Ferrous Sulfate, Niacin, Thiamin, Riboflavin, Folic Acid), Nonfat Milk, Reconstituted Potatoes (From Potato Flour), Yeast, Sugar, Wheat Gluten, Sunflower Oil, Contains 2 Percent Or Less Of Each Of The Following: Salt, Butter, Dough Conditioners (Sodium Stearoyl Lactylate, Monoglycerides And Diglycerides), Monocalcium Phosphate, Calcium Propionate (A ), Guar Gum, Ascorbic Acid, Datem, Calcium Sulfate, Enzymes, Turmeric Color, Annatto Color, Sesame Seeds, Unbleached Enriched Wheat Flour (Flour, Ferrous Sulfate, Niacin, Thiamin, Riboflavin, Folic Acid), Sesame Seeds

What is a Vegetarian diet?

A vegetarian diet eliminates meat, poultry, and fish but typically includes dairy, eggs, and plant-based foods. People adopt it for ethical, environmental, or health reasons. This diet emphasizes fruits, vegetables, legumes, grains, nuts, and seeds as key nutrient sources. Vegetarians often get protein from eggs, tofu, beans, and lentils. It can offer health benefits such as reduced risk of heart disease and improved weight management, though attention should be given to nutrients like iron, zinc, and vitamin B12. With proper planning, a vegetarian diet can be both nutritionally complete and sustainable.
